The AW is an incredible rifle in every respect from my experience, but for a hunting rifle...especially one I would be hauling up and down mountainsides when hunting purely for sport/pleasure, I would look elsewhere!

The problem is basically the weight which on the 300WM AIAW is just shy of 15lbs (6.8kg) without mag, ammo, optics/mount, etc. Tack on all the bells and whistles and you are quickly approaching an 18lb+ rifle which isn't what I would call and ideal "mountain rifle" for goat-getting by any means.

If you do decide on the AIAW, then the biathlon type slings or something like an Eberlestock or similar pack equipped to carry a heavy-duty rifle would be a must in my mind.

I use mine for everything. Yes its heavier than some, but if you want to use the same weapon for both steel and hunting then I think it would be fine. Carrying a load with the biathlon sling is easy or a descent pack so you can store the weapon and supplies. I have seen more people carry 15-20lbs of gucci gear, food and accessories for the just in case and not complain. I find once its on the back like a back pack its done from there. So if you have found one at a good price I would suggest grabbing it no matter what, it can always be useful. Now on the other hand, there are some much lighter weapons designed for hunting that I would look at as well for that application but they are not the target guns. The Steyr SBS Prohunter and Tikka T3's for this are light, extremely accurate, simple yet very durable. I have built a many of these in both the .300WM and 7RM for hunting rigs and for 3 rounds in under an inch even at 200yds with quality ammo is not uncommon.
